Replacing Titleist 690 CB's ...Any suggestions on what I should try out??


Note: This thread is 5039 days old. We appreciate that you found this thread instead of starting a new one, but if you plan to post here please make sure it's still relevant. If not, please start a new topic. Thank you!

Recommended Posts

Posted

Hey,

I am looking to upgrade my iron's and am currently using the Titleist 690 CB's from eon's ago. I am a 10 handicap, though last year was a terrible year, and I usually play to about a 7. I was thinking of looking at Titleist, but am open to Mizzuno and others. I have been out of the iron game for so long that I don't know what's good these days. I prefer a thin topline (which usually means no callaways) and would like cavity / muscle back combo. Can't hit a full blade really and don't want a cavity back club designed for a 30 handicapper. Don't get me wrong I need forgiveness but still want workability. Oh and I am okay with getting used, but just want something a little newer.

Well the Titleist 710 CB's are very similar to the 690's except they are a satin finish.  Other than that I would recommend the Mizuno MP59's  and the TaylorMade MC's
